A number of novel N ‐substituted‐1,8‐naphthalimides have been prepared and their fluorescence yields measured in water at p H 7.4. The type of substitutent and the substitution pattern on the naphthalimide nucleus produce markedly different fluorescence yields, (quantum efficiencies, ø varying from ø = 0‐0037 for N ‐(3‐N'‐morpholino‐1‐propyl)‐4‐amino‐3‐methoxy‐1,8‐naphthalirnide (7) to ø = 0–77 for N ‐(3‐bromopropyl)‐4‐acetamido‐1,8‐naphthalimide (31).
